I have never been a big anti-lead person, but this one can get rid of the other lead, set up rocks, AND get rid of rocks. Donphan's typing, stats, and moves are all perfect in conjunction. So here's my set:

[SET]
name: OU Anti-Lead
move 1: Earthquake
move 2: Stone Edge
move 3: Rapid Spin
move 4: Ice Shard/Stealth Rock
item: Life Orb/Lum Berry
nature: Adamant
evs:252 HP / 252 Atk / 4 Spe
Why this set deserves to be on-site:
-This is unlike most other leads
-Currently no set like this on Donphan
-Keeps out rocks on your side
-Can still work late game
Additional Comments:
-Outclasses Starmie in physical powerand bulk, typing, SR, priority, and coverage.
-Outclassed by Starmie in speed, and special.
-Beats almost all common leads, which includes Aerodactyl, Azelf, Infernape, Jirachi, Ninjask, Machamp, and Metagross. Roserade, Hippowdon and Swampert being the three in the top 10 that aren't beaten.
-Ice Shard is the preferred choice to hit Ninjask and Gliscor or whatever is switched in after beating the opponent's lead. But SR can be useful for obvious reasons.
-Evs allow Mixpert leads to be unable to OHKO Donphan, and Machamp leads are unable to 2HKO it. The max attack allows many OHKO's and aren't useful anywhere else.
-Adamant nature is required for it to work at all, so Impish isn't a good idea.
-Life Orb vs Lum berry depends on if you want more power or the safety from sleep leads (Roserade...).
Teammates and Counters:
-Being a lead, team mates aren't very useful, but a Blissey would help as to absorb special attacks and cause switches.
-Also a grass abuser could also be used for Swampert, so Roserade could be useful to add toxic spikes to the mix for stall teams. It can also absorb toxic spikes and fight and defend specially.
-His counters are Swampert because even when it can't OHKO Donphan, it is still a potential wall to Donphan. The best thing to do is to switch immediately SR.
-Smeargle and Roserade can be threats without a sleep absorber, even though they are both OHKO'd by Earthquake.
-Bronzong, Empoleon, and Froslass leads can also be scary, so just switch to a set-up sweeper like Gyarados and then they can't do anything about it.
